Brute force vulnerability in M-Files user authentication
CVE-2023-6912
9.8CRITICAL
What is CVE-2023-6912?
M-Files Server before version 23.12.13205.0 is susceptible to a brute force attack due to inadequate protections against multiple authentication attempts. This allows attackers to exploit the system by attempting unlimited guesses on user accounts, potentially resulting in unauthorized access and compromise of sensitive data. Organizations using affected versions should prioritize updating their systems to enhance security and protect user credentials.

Affected Version(s)
M-Files Server 0 < 23.12.13205.0
M-Files Server 23.2 LTS SR6
M-Files Server 23.8 LTS SR4
